Shepheard Epstein Hunter in London is seeking architects and technologists to join their team, focusing on residential and education sector projects across the UK. The ideal candidates will possess excellent technical detailing and Revit skills, along with a firm understanding of UK building regulations.
They will benefit from a competitive salary up to £45K, ARB fees, 33 days of annual leave, and a commitment to professional development.

How to prepare for a job interview at Shepheard Epstein Hunter
✨Know Your Technical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your technical detailing and Revit skills before the interview. Be ready to discuss specific projects where you've applied these skills, as this will show your expertise and confidence in your abilities.
✨Understand UK Building Regulations
Familiarise yourself with the latest UK building regulations relevant to residential and education projects. Being able to reference these during your interview will demonstrate your knowledge and commitment to compliance, which is crucial for the role.
✨Showcase Your Portfolio
Prepare a well-organised portfolio that highlights your best work in residential and educational architecture. Be ready to discuss the challenges you faced in each project and how you overcame them, as this will give insight into your problem-solving skills.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Come prepared with thoughtful questions about the company’s projects and future direction. This not only shows your interest in the role but also gives you a chance to assess if the company aligns with your career goals.
